> I am trying to image 3 identical Dell Systems in my Server farm. One=20
> of the three is running well, while the other two have several=20
> annoying user issues. I have given up on making ghost work so I tried=20
> to break the mirror
> on the one that is stable and place that disk in the one of the ones
that
> is
> not stable. I followed the directions in the Citrix article "Imaging
> Metaframe XP using Ghost 6.5.1".=20
>=20
> =20
>=20
> The steps I took were:
>=20
> =20
>=20
> Server1 =3D Server I am breaking mirror on (Stable server)
>=20
> Server2 =3D Server I am placing Server 1's disk into
>=20
> =20
>=20
> 1.    Shut down server2 and remove its second disk so I have a backup
of
> the current configuration I can revert to if the mirror image does not

> work..
> 2.    Boot server2 and remove it from all published apps.
> 3.    Uninstall metaframe on server2 to remove it from the farm.
> 4.    Confirm server2 no longer shows up in the server list of the
other
> servers in the farm.
> 5.    Shutdown server2 and remove the second drive. Put 2nd drive from
> server 1 in Server 2. Server 2 now has only one unmirrored drive that=20
> is a mirror copy of server 1.
> 6.    Unplug server2's network cables and boot.
> 7.    Server 2 now is exact image of server 1. Logon and remove server
2
> from domain.=20
> 8.    On domain pdc remove server2 from domain as well. Necessary
since
> server 2 is not plugged into network at this point.
> 9.    Change IP address of server 2.
> 10.   stop ima service and set it to manual.
> 11.   remove wsid=3D line from mf20.dsn file
> 12.   delete wfcname.ini file
> 13.   delete rmlocaldatabase files
> 14.   Run sysinternals NEWSID app to replace SID.
> 15.   reboot and plug server2 into network
> 16.   log on to server and add back to domain.
> 17.   edit the mf20.dsn file document does not say to add WSID line
back
> (is this correct?). Confirm Server and UID are correct. No changes
made.
> 18.   recreate rmlocaldatabase file
> 19.   Set IMA to auto and reboot.
>=20
> =20
>=20
> After I reboot I am able to see the server I just recreated in the=20
> resource manager of another server. I am even able to publish its=20
> desktop. The IMA service starts and no errors show up in either the=20
> Application log or the System log on either Server 1 or server 2. But=20
> I cannot log onto either server though ica and when I open the cmc at=20
> the console it hangs. If I try
> to log on through nfuse I get an unspecified error when trying to
retrieve
> published applications. In looking through the document there are a
couple
> things that I do slightly differently but I am not sure how to confirm
if
> they are an issue.=20
>=20
> =20
>=20
> 1. It says not to add any licenses to the image but since I am using a

> working copy of server1 I could not remove licenses before the image.=20
> When I look at the licenses for server 2 from the CMC of server 3=20
> (only one I can
> open) no licenses are showing.
>=20
> =20
>=20
> 2. I did not run sysprep but instead newsid. Should be fine since I do

> not need it to redetect hardware.
>=20
> =20
>=20
> 3. I removed the wsid from the mf20.dsn file but never re-added=20
> anything back. Does not seem right but directions did not specify=20
> adding anything back.
>=20
> =20
>=20
> =20
>=20
> That's it. Any ideas would be greatly appreciated.
